How Can I Optimize My Systeme.io Site For SEO: Choose Relevant Keywords
When optimizing our website for search engines, one of the first steps we need to take is choosing relevant keywords.
Our target audience will likely use these words and phrases when searching for our products or services. We can perform keyword research using various online tools to do this effectively.
These tools will help us identify keywords with high search volumes and low competition.
In addition to identifying general keywords, we should also focus on long-tail keywords. Long-tail keywords are more specific and usually consist of multiple words.
While they may have lower search volumes, they often have higher conversion rates because they reflect the specific intent of users.
By incorporating long-tail keywords into our content, we can attract more targeted traffic to our website.
To further refine our keyword choices, we can utilize keyword planner tools.
These tools provide insights into the search volume, competition level, and potential keyword bid estimates.
By analyzing this data, we can make informed decisions about the keywords that will be most effective for our SEO strategy.
Another helpful approach is to analyze our competitors’ keywords.
By understanding which keywords our competitors are targeting, we can gain insights into potential gaps in the market or discover new keyword opportunities.
This competitive analysis can also provide us with ideas for content creation and allow us to differentiate ourselves from our competitors.
Create High-Quality Content
Once we have identified the keywords we want to target, creating high-quality content that aligns with those keywords is crucial.
Our content must be original, informative, and valuable to our target audience. By providing valuable content, we can establish ourselves as an authority in our industry and attract a loyal following.
In addition to creating original content, we should optimize it for our targeted keywords.
This involves incorporating the keywords naturally throughout the content without keyword stuffing.
We can place keywords in our content’s title, headings, and body to signal what our content is about to search engines.
Heading tags (H1, H2, H3, etc.) can structure our content and improve its readability.
Using appropriate heading tags makes navigating and understanding our content easier for users and search engines.
This is particularly important for search engine crawlers that scan our website for relevant information.
We should include relevant images and alt text to enhance our content further.
Visual elements make our content more engaging and allow us to include keywords in the alt text. Alt text describes the image for users who cannot view it, and including relevant keywords in this text can help improve our SEO.
Bullet points and subheadings can also improve the readability of our content.
By breaking up our text into smaller, digestible chunks, we make it easier for users to skim through the content and find the information they are looking for.
This also helps search engines understand the structure of our content and the key points we are addressing.
Optimize Meta Tags
Meta tags play a vital role in informing search engines about the content of our web pages.
We can optimize our meta tags to improve our website’s visibility in search engine results pages (SERPs) and entice users to click through to our website.
One important meta tag is the title tag, which appears as the clickable headline in search engine results.
It is essential to craft unique and descriptive title tags that accurately reflect the content of our web pages. Including targeted keywords in our title tags can help improve the relevancy of our website in search results.
Another meta tag to optimize is the meta description.
This is the summary that appears below the title tag in search results.
A compelling meta description that accurately describes our content and includes targeted keywords can entice users to click on our website.
Including targeted keywords in other meta tags, such as the meta keywords tag, can also help improve our website’s visibility in search results.
However, it is worth noting that the impact of the meta keywords tag on search rankings has diminished over time.
Nevertheless, including relevant keywords in this tag can still provide some value.
Build a Strong Internal Linking Structure
Building a strong internal linking structure within our website is essential for SEO. Internal links connect different website pages, allowing search engine crawlers to navigate and understand our website’s structure.
When creating internal links, it is important to use relevant anchor text. Anchor text is the clickable text that forms a hyperlink.
Using descriptive and relevant anchor text, rather than generic phrases like “click here,” helps search engines understand the context and relevance of the linked pages.
Linking to relevant internal pages within our content can also enhance the user experience and improve the flow of information.
By providing users with additional resources or related content, we can keep them engaged and encourage them to explore further within our website.
Proper navigation is critical for both users and search engines.
By ensuring that our website has clear and intuitive navigation, we make it easier for users to find the information they are looking for.
This also helps search engines understand the hierarchy and organization of our website.
Breadcrumbs can enhance the user experience and improve our website’s structure.
Breadcrumbs are a navigational aid that displays the user’s current location within the website hierarchy.
They provide users with a clear path back to previous pages and make navigating our website easier.
Optimize URL Structure
The structure of our website’s URLs can impact our SEO.
It is essential to use clean and descriptive URLs that accurately reflect the content of our web pages.
A clean URL is concise, easy to read, and does not contain unnecessary parameters or characters.
Including targeted keywords in our URLs can also help improve their relevancy in search results.
When creating URLs, we should aim to include relevant keywords that accurately describe the content of the specific page.
However, it is important to balance and avoid keyword stuffing in URLs.
To create user-friendly URLs, we should avoid using special characters or numbers that can make our URLs appear complicated and difficult to read.
Using words that describe the page’s content, separated by hyphens, can make our URLs more user-friendly and easily understood by users and search engines.
Improve Website Speed and Performance
Website speed and performance are crucial factors in SEO. Search engines prioritize websites that load quickly and provide a seamless user experience.
We can take several steps to optimize our website’s speed and performance.
One important aspect is optimizing image sizes. Large, uncompressed images can significantly slow down our website’s loading time.
We can reduce the file size and improve loading speed by resizing and compressing images without sacrificing quality.
Minimizing HTTP requests is another effective technique.
We can achieve this by minimizing the number of elements on our web pages that require separate requests, such as images, scripts, and stylesheets.
Combining and compressing these elements can help reduce the overall number of HTTP requests, resulting in faster loading times.
Enabling browser caching can also improve website speed.
When a user visits our website, the browser can store some aspects in a cache, allowing subsequent visits to load faster.
By leveraging browser caching, we can enhance the overall user experience and decrease load times.
Compressing CSS and JavaScript files can further optimize our website’s performance.
By reducing the file size of these files, we can minimize the time it takes for the browser to download and process them.
This can lead to faster rendering and improved loading speed.
Ensure Mobile-Friendliness
With the increasing use of mobile devices for internet browsing, ensuring that our website is mobile-friendly is essential.
A mobile-friendly website provides a better user experience and affects our SEO rankings.
Responsive design is a key component of mobile-friendliness.
Responsive websites adapt to different screen sizes and resolutions, providing an optimal viewing experience across various devices.
By implementing responsive design, we can ensure that our website looks and functions well on desktop and mobile devices.
Optimizing font sizes for mobile devices is also important.
Text too small or difficult to read on a mobile screen can lead to a poor user experience.
Using appropriate font sizes can make our content more legible and improve mobile device user experience.
Enabling Accelerated Mobile Pages (AMP) can enhance our website’s mobile-friendliness.
AMP technology allows websites to load instantly on mobile devices, resulting in a seamless and fast user experience.
Implementing AMP can potentially boost our website’s visibility in mobile search results.
Testing our website on different devices is crucial to ensure its mobile-friendliness.
Using various devices and screen sizes, we can identify any issues or inconsistencies and make the necessary adjustments to optimize our website for a wide range of mobile devices.
Create XML Sitemap
An XML sitemap is a file that lists all the pages on our website, providing search engines with valuable information about the structure and content of our website.
Creating and submitting an XML sitemap can help search engines discover our web pages more efficiently and prioritize them for indexing.
To generate an XML sitemap, we can use a sitemap generator tool.
This tool will crawl our website, collect information about each page, and create an XML sitemap file that we can upload to our website’s root directory.
Submitting our XML sitemap to search engines is an essential step.
By submitting the sitemap through the respective search engine’s webmaster tools, we notify the search engine about the existence and structure of our website.
This improves the chances of indexing and ranking our web pages in search results.
Updating our XML sitemap regularly is important to ensure that search engines have the latest information about our website.
As we create new content or change existing pages, we should update our XML sitemap and resubmit it to search engines.
This helps search engines stay up-to-date with our website’s content and index our latest pages.

Monitor and Analyze SEO Performance
Monitoring and analyzing our SEO performance is crucial to fine-tuning our strategy and identifying areas for improvement.
By implementing Google Analytics, tracking keyword rankings, and analyzing website traffic, we can gain valuable insights into our website’s performance.
Google Analytics provides a wealth of data about our website, including the number of visitors, their behavior on our site, and conversion rates.
By analyzing this data, we can understand which aspects of our SEO strategy are working well and which areas need optimization.
Tracking keyword rankings allows us to monitor our website’s visibility in search results.
By regularly checking our rankings for targeted keywords, we can identify trends and adjust our content and optimization strategy as needed.
Analyzing website traffic provides insights into our traffic sources, such as organic search, social media, or referrals.
By understanding where our traffic is coming from, we can assess the effectiveness of our marketing efforts and allocate resources accordingly.
Identifying and fixing SEO issues is an ongoing process.
By regularly monitoring and analyzing our SEO performance, we can identify any technical or content-related issues affecting our rankings. Fixing these issues promptly can help improve our website’s visibility and overall SEO performance.
